// This file is generated by WOK (CPPExt).
// Please do not edit this file; modify original file instead.
// The copyright and license terms as defined for the original file apply to 
// this header file considered to be the "object code" form of the original source.

#ifndef _ShapeConstruct_CompBezierCurves2dToBSplineCurve2d_HeaderFile
#define _ShapeConstruct_CompBezierCurves2dToBSplineCurve2d_HeaderFile

#include <Standard.hxx>
#include <Standard_DefineAlloc.hxx>
#include <Standard_Macro.hxx>

#include <Convert_SequenceOfArray1OfPoles2d.hxx>
#include <TColgp_SequenceOfPnt2d.hxx>
#include <TColStd_SequenceOfReal.hxx>
#include <TColStd_SequenceOfInteger.hxx>
#include <Standard_Integer.hxx>
#include <Standard_Real.hxx>
#include <Standard_Boolean.hxx>
class Standard_ConstructionError;
class TColgp_Array1OfPnt2d;
class TColStd_Array1OfReal;
class TColStd_Array1OfInteger;


//! Converts a list  of connecting Bezier Curves 2d to  a
//! BSplineCurve 2d.
//! if possible, the continuity of the BSpline will be
//! increased to more than C0.
class ShapeConstruct_CompBezierCurves2dToBSplineCurve2d 
{
public:

  DEFINE_STANDARD_ALLOC

  
  Standard_EXPORT ShapeConstruct_CompBezierCurves2dToBSplineCurve2d(const Standard_Real AngularTolerance = 1.0e-4);
  
  Standard_EXPORT   void AddCurve (const TColgp_Array1OfPnt2d& Poles) ;
  
  //! Computes the algorithm.
  Standard_EXPORT   void Perform() ;
  
  Standard_EXPORT   Standard_Integer Degree()  const;
  
  Standard_EXPORT   Standard_Integer NbPoles()  const;
  
  Standard_EXPORT   void Poles (TColgp_Array1OfPnt2d& Poles)  const;
  
  Standard_EXPORT   Standard_Integer NbKnots()  const;
  
  Standard_EXPORT   void KnotsAndMults (TColStd_Array1OfReal& Knots, TColStd_Array1OfInteger& Mults)  const;




protected:





private:



  Convert_SequenceOfArray1OfPoles2d mySequence;
  TColgp_SequenceOfPnt2d CurvePoles;
  TColStd_SequenceOfReal CurveKnots;
  TColStd_SequenceOfInteger KnotsMultiplicities;
  Standard_Integer myDegree;
  Standard_Real myAngular;
  Standard_Boolean myDone;


};







#endif // _ShapeConstruct_CompBezierCurves2dToBSplineCurve2d_HeaderFile
